What is the minimum budget for Goa trip?
If you are doing a backpacking trip to Goa and staying in hostels, the minimum per day cost should come around Rs. 1200 – 1500 including stay, food and bike rent (if you plan to take one). If you are not planning a backpacking trip, it can go up to Rs. 3000 – 4000 per day.
Which time is best for Goa?
When is the Best Time to Visit Goa? The best time to visit Goa is in November and between February to May when temperatures are between 20°C to 33°C. This avoids the monsoon and the peak tourist season of December-January, so beaches are not overcrowded and good deals can be found for airfares and rooms.

Is North Goa better or south Goa?
North Goa is good for you if you like to be around large crowds and a convivial atmosphere all the time. On the other hand, if you prefer some alone time or a quiet walk on the beach or on the streets, south Goa is the place to be.

Is Goa cheap for a holiday?
For travellers on a budget
While not as affordable as it once was, Goa still has plenty of opportunities for a cheap holiday. In areas like Cavelossim, in South Goa, you’ll find budget, family-run accommodation close to the beach and bustling towns.

Is April a good month for Goa?
April is officially the summer season in India and Goa.But it’s still good to visit Goa this month, just make sure that you avoid direct sunlight exposure when the sun is at its hottest. The average highs are about the same as March, but the average low temperature is higher, so April is generally a hotter month.
